I received the following email from ReadRevenue after a did a cash out. I do all the searches so they is no reason to charge me a charge back for not searching. I received no money. (IMG:style_emoticons/default/wallbash.gif)

hello,
I am sorry to tell you that our scripts show that you did not do valid search in earch ad when you read them. So your current paid mail earnings has been charged back. Please understand that this step was taken in an effort to protect the interest of our advertisers. Cause we got our advertisers complaint that the search ad result is poor recently. The changed earnings on your account will be properly returned to the affected advertisers.
I don't force you to do searches, but If you want be paid and earn more in future, Please support us and do valid search for every search ad when you are reading every search paid mails. and if you do that, our scripts would set you to be an active member automatically, and you would receive more paid emails. if you are busy, you don't need to read every paid mail every day. And if you don't like search ad, please delete them ! We all know that:
good ad results will bring more advertisers and more paid emails.
poor ad results will make less and less emails,even end with close site.
So please continue support our advertisers! Show us your active, make more advertisers come back!
Maybe you dont know How to do a valid search, here is the explain:
step 1: click a keyword or make a web search from protal page.
step 2: click one of the search results.

If you have any questions please don't hesitate to contact us.

kind regards

ReadRevenue.com

To the searchers who faithfully do the valid searches:

One issue that I have come across recently is that the many sites that I belong to require about 200+ searches daily. Now if you do the math between all available pay per whatever search engines, there is a problem. In the terms of most of the engines, it blatantly states in some form or another that a fixed number of searches are alloted to each IP address. And recently, I have been getting messages stating that I am over the alloted feeds per day. So I have started cutting and pasting these messages for both my and admin's benefit so that they get off of my back. Yes, advertisers will come back if their stat sheets aren't registering tons of clicks, bots, and the like.

My stat sheets are a disgrace (IMG:style_emoticons/default/ticked.gif) and I want to know what the benefit is of turing numbers when bots still get through!!! (IMG:style_emoticons/default/wallbash.gif) (IMG:style_emoticons/default/wallbash.gif) (IMG:style_emoticons/default/wallbash.gif)

The moral of the story is to protect yourself because some of the paid to read's probably won't back you if you go down for fraud or anything like that. And there are a ton that do not require searches, as I have found out the hard way!!! (IMG:style_emoticons/default/dirol.gif)
